To be Marked is to be claimed. To be claimed is to no longer belong to yourself. ➵ ────୨ৎ──── In a world where human lives mean nothing, every choice leads to death, sooner or later. When Xyrena Draven turns eighteen, she has only three options: Enter the academy, receive a Mark from the gods and survive long enough to reach the fourth year to train as a dragon rider, join the military, or spend her life as a slave with no future. Like most people, she chooses the most dangerous path. The Mark she receives is not a gift, but a forbidden curse. Its power slowly destroys her body and makes her a target for those in power. While being hunted, Xyrena is tied to Kaelen Rodrigues, the Crown Prince who should be her enemy and the only person who can either save her or destroy her. As a revolution begins to rise, the world demands one final decision. book 1 of The Ashes of Edrathis Trilogy Blair Nightwyck remembers nothing of her life before the war-only screams, fire, and her uncle's rough hands dragging her from the ashes. The story he told her was simple: her parents were slaughtered by a dragon during the Great War between Shifters and mankind. That the monsters deserved their extinction. That her survival was a curse she would spend the rest of her life repaying. For years she's been his weapon, his trapper-chasing and capturing what others fear, selling the rare and the dangerous for his profit while she dreams of freedom she'll never taste. Until the crown makes her an offer. A job dangerous enough to kill her. Lucrative enough to buy her freedom. All she has to do is work for the king-hunt creatures the realm believes extinct-and in return, she'll finally earn her way out of her uncle's chains. But when she meets Lieutenant Malachi Ryerson, the man assigned to train and accompany her, her carefully built world begins to unravel. He's powerful, commanding, impossibly magnetic-and hiding something that makes the air around him hum with danger. Something ancient. Something that should not exist. The deeper she's drawn into his shadow, the more she begins to question everything she's ever known about monsters, about the war... and about herself. Because in Edrathis, truth is as deadly as magic-and the monster she's been hunting may not be the one wearing claws.

Once upon a time, thousands of years ago, men and fae lived side by side. These were often dark times, as men had little means to defend themselves from the powerful creatures capable of destroying villages in mere seconds. Through bloody battle and tough negotiations with the High Faerie nobility, an agreement of sorts had been reached: A Treaty. Men on the southern half of the continent, Faeries on the top half. Plain and simple... Until it isn't. Ella Blackwell has duties. Insurmountable, crushing duties. As the Duke's daughter, she's been born and raised to accomplish what all women in Rhothomir's high society are meant to do-marry well, secure an alliance, and bear the perfect heirs to continue traditions. Except, Ella's not really the perfect blue-blooded aristocrat she's expected to be. In the midst of rising political tensions between the Kingdom of Rhothomir and Fae Realm, and a blooming war, Ella finds her life completely upended from one moment to the next, ripped away from everything she's ever known. Follow along for a High Fantasy adventure full of Faerie royalty, courtly intrigue, backstabbing nobles, political schemes, steel-strong friendship and love.
